摘要

采用基于GGA+U形式的密度泛函计算方法研究了sb掺杂Na0.785CoO2的电子性质。结果表明,Sb掺杂剂在取代复合Na0.875CoO2晶格结构中的Co离子时最稳定。我们还发现SbCo掺杂剂采用了?+?5氧化态引入两个电子到宿主Na0.875CoO2化合物中。新引入的电子与由钠空位产生的Co4+位点上的空穴重新结合。Co4+的去除使Na0.875(Co0.9375Sb0.0625)O2无磁性,降低了化合物的热电效应。此外,SbCo掺杂剂倾向于以Na空位保持最小距离的方式聚集。这里得出的结论可以推广到NaxCoO2中取代Co的其他高度氧化掺杂物。

Suppression of magnetism and Seebeck effect in Na0.875CoO2 induced by SbCo dopants

We examined the electronic property of Sb-doped Na0.785CoO2 using density functional calculations based on GGA+U formalism. We demonstrated that Sb dopants were the most stable when replacing Co ions within the complex Na0.875CoO2 lattice structure. We also showed that the SbCo dopants adopted the?+?5 oxidation state introducing two electrons into the host Na0.875CoO2 compound. The newly introduced electrons recombined with holes that were borne on Co4+ sites that had been created by sodium vacancies. The elimination of Co4+ species, in turn, rendered Na0.875(Co0.9375Sb0.0625)O2 non-magnetic and diminished the compound’s thermoelectric effect. Furthermore, the SbCo dopants tended to aggregate with the Na vacancies keeping a minimum distance. The conclusions drawn here can be generalised to other highly oxidised dopants in NaxCoO2 that replace a Co.
